I fished Line Creek pond this morning for a couple of hours with a couple of 4’6” Palms Quattro XUL’s paired with Shimano Soare bb500spg’s , one with 2# Flouroclear, one with braid .
Jigs were handties on size 12 streamer hooks and 3.8mm Tungsten beads . A hair under 1/64oz .
Weather was upper 70’s , low 80’s , partly cloudy, and windy 11-20mph .
I was hoping the tree lined pond would shield me from the wind and it did a pretty good job until about 12:30 and the wind picked up .
Both combos cast about the same , the braid would blow around a little more , but I could feel bites better with the braid . One fish grabbed my jig on the fall with a big bow in my line and I could feel the take .
I also took a 5’4” St Croix Trout series ULF and tried it , both with the braid and the Floroclear with similar results. The extra 10” of rod didn’t give any advantages over the shorter Quattro.
Below the pond is a nice creek from which the park is named for Line Creek .
It’s the feeder creek to Lake McIntosh I fish a good bit .
The creek was low but I was able to find one spot deep enough to hold a fun little redbreast .
I didn’t travel far down the creek , because I’d already been standing for almost an hour and half fishing and the way out is pretty steep for an old fart . And going downstream would have added more hill and rocks to climb .
I caught nine total .
I considered it a fun successful trip .
